International Museum Day is marked annually on May 18th and was started in 1977 by the International Council of Museums to celebrate institutions around the world. The aim is to celebrate museums as an important means of cultural exchange, enrichment of cultures, and development of mutual understanding, cooperation, and peace among peoples. As incomparable places of discovery, museums teach us about our past and open our minds to new ideas - two essential steps in building a better future.

Take a stroll around Exton Park (located at Swedesford Rd. and Church Farm Ln.) to enjoy the lovely weather and come to see our newly installed StoryWalk® book in collaboration with our Summer Reading theme ‘Oceans of Possibilities.’ This summer we are featuring the Caldecott Honor-winning book “A Couple of Boys Have the Best Week Ever” written and illustrated by Marla Frazee. She wonderfully captures the very essence of summer vacation and what it means to be a kid in this moving and hilarious celebration of young boys, childhood friendships, and the power of the imagination.
